What is the DASS 42 Psychological Assessment Form?
The DASS 42 is a psychological assessment form designed to evaluate the severity of symptoms related to depression, anxiety, and stress. Its purpose in mental health assessment is to provide insights into an individual's emotional state, thereby aiding in effective treatment planning. The form comprises 42 questions where respondents rate statements based on their experiences over the previous week, using a simple rating system.
This tool is commonly utilized in both clinical settings and personal evaluation contexts. Its structured approach allows mental health professionals and individuals to gain valuable insights into their mental health status.

Key Features of the DASS 42 Psychological Assessment Form
Several features contribute to the effectiveness of the DASS 42 in mental health assessment:
-
Structured questionnaire that facilitates clear understanding.
-
Scoring method that categorizes results into normal to extremely severe levels.
-
Fillable format enhances accessibility and ease of use.
These features help ensure that respondents can accurately represent their mental health status.
